Licence Check: How to Verify a UKGC Licence
Verifying a casino’s licence is a simple process. Go to the UK Gambling Commission’s public register on their website. Enter the casino’s name or the licence number. The register will show the licence status, the licensee’s name, and any conditions or restrictions. For example, William Hill operates under WHG (International) Limited, with UKGC account number 39225. You can confirm this on the register.
This step is crucial for player safety. A valid UKGC licence means the operator must follow strict rules on fair play, data protection, and responsible gambling. If a site isn’t on the register, do not play there. The register also shows if the operator has been fined or had its licence suspended. Checking this before you deposit is a matter of minutes and gives you peace of mind.

Disputes and Complaints: Your Rights as a Player
If you have a dispute with a casino, the first step is to contact their customer support. Most operators have a complaints procedure outlined in their terms. If you cannot resolve the issue, you can escalate it to an Alternative Dispute Resolution (ADR) service. The Independent Betting Adjudication Service (IBAS) is the most common ADR for UKGC-licensed sites. You can submit your case on their website. The ADR will review the evidence from both sides and make a binding decision. If the operator refuses to comply with the ADR’s ruling, you can report them to the UK Gambling Commission. The Commission can fine the operator or revoke their licence. Keeping records of all communications, screenshots of terms, and transaction histories is essential for building a strong case.
